PART Debts and Deductions
Allowable debts and deductions must meet both of the following criteria:
A. The decedent was legally responsible for payment,and the estate is insufficient ho pay the deductible items.
B. You paid the debts after the death of the decedent and can furnish proof of payment if requested by the department.
